How much do director hris implementation jobs pay per year?

As of May 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for director hris implementation in the United States is $103,518.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$75,500.00 and $121,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

POSITION OVERVIEW
The Director of HRIS & Compliance serves as a strategic leader within Human Resources, responsible for managing the digital infrastructure, employee benefit programs, and organizational compliance frameworks that support InVision Human Services' mission. This role oversees the optimization of HR information systems, ensures the effective administration of benefits, and leads compliance initiatives that align with regulatory requirements and organizational values. The Director provides thought leadership, drives process efficiency, and ensures consistency, accuracy, and transparency across all operations. The Director will provide hands-on leadership, operational support, training and oversight, and create a reliable information support structure for employees and HR team members.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
HRIS Leadership & Optimization
  • Lead the strategic direction, implementation, maintenance, and optimization of HRIS platforms.
  • Partner with cross-functional teams to streamline workflows and automate HR operations.
  • Evaluate and implement new technology solutions to improve HR service delivery.
  • Oversee HR data governance, reporting, dashboards, and analytics to support decision-making.
  • Troubleshoot system issues and coordinate resolutions with vendors.
  • Manage reporting, data pulls, dashboards, and scheduled system tasks.
  • Identify opportunities to streamline HR processes and automate routine tasks, improve self-service workflows and processes to increase efficiency.

Benefits Administration:
  • Direct and oversee all employee benefits programs, including health plans, retirement, leave management, wellness programs, and voluntary benefits.
  • Lead annual benefits renewal, vendor relationships, and open enrollment planning and execution.
  • Analyze plan performance, cost trends, and utilization; provide recommendations to ensure competitive, cost-effective offerings.
  • Ensure employees receive timely, clear communication and support regarding all benefits-related matters.

Compliance & Risk Mitigation:
  • Ensure HR policies, practices, and documentation comply with federal, state, and local regulations (FLSA, ADA, FMLA, ACA, HIPAA, EEO, etc.).
  • Oversee internal audits, reporting, and recordkeeping to maintain compliance standards.
  • Monitor legislative and regulatory changes and proactively prepare the organization for required updates.
  • Serve as the subject matter expert and resource for surveys, regulatory data responses and other compliance-related inquiries.

Leadership, Collaboration & Strategy:
  • Partner with the CHRO and HR leadership team to develop long-term HR systems, benefits, and compliance strategies.
  • Provide coaching and guidance to HR team members in HRIS, benefits, and compliance functions.
  • Support organizational change management initiatives through clear, consistent processes and communication.
  • Ensure all systems, benefits programs, and compliance efforts reflect the Mission, Vision, and Values of InVision.
